Work item: F.MDDSP
Subject/title: Architecture and functional requirements for the multimedia data delivery service platform

Summary: With the explosive growth of multimedia data, there is an urgent need for cross-field data circulation, and the potential for integrating and applying data across various industries is substantial. However, the data flow process requires collaboration among multiple platforms to accomplish related tasks. During this collaboration, different platforms often lack a unified task scheduling platform, consistent identity verification, and a coherent delivery process. These challenges adversely affect the overall efficiency and interoperability of cross-platform data product delivery. Therefore, it is essential to establish a unified and standardized architecture for the multimedia data delivery service platform, ensuring smooth and efficient data circulation between different entities. This draft Recommendation outlines the architecture and functional requirements for the Multimedia Data Delivery Service Platform (MDDSP). It achieves interaction management, delivery scheduling, order transfer, operation management, delivery method management, unified identification, identity verification, data product directory and other functions. The platform also supports additional capabilities to meet various data delivery needs in different scenarios.
